FEATURES

/square6 RoHS compliant /square6 Toroidal construction /square6 Up to 4.1A IDC /square6 Inductance range from 0.5 to 5.0mH /square6 Small footprint /square6 UL 94V-0 packaging materials /square6 Low DC resistance /square6 Guaranteed 3.0mm creepage and clearance between windings The 5200 series is a range of through-hole common mode chokes designed to attenuate up to 100MHz common mode noise where line filtering is required, such as high current switching power supplies and telecom applications.
